Choosing The Right Home Builder

The first step in the process of choosing the right home builder is defining your needs. Of, course, you will have to determine what size, type, and price range of home you need.

Once you have thought about the type of house you want, down to the specifics, you can start creating a list of potential builders. You can do this by contacting your local home builders’ association to obtain a list of builders who construct homes in your area.

This list will also tell you whether the builder is licensed and adequately insured. However, note that not every state or area requires builders to be licensed. What is important is that you, the client, are also covered during the building process.

Take into consideration experience and positive reviews. Are past buyers satisfied? Ask for references from past home buyers if you must. Some would even try visiting a builder’s recently built home, if possible, and interview the homeowner with some questions. At the very least, drive by and see if the homes are visually appealing.

Ask yourself, is there a design fit between what type of home you want and what this builder can actually build? Does this builder actually specialize in the style of home you seek? Look for a builder whose work includes at least some examples of the style of home you want. While in that process, try inquiring about the warranty as well and look for a structural warranty of ten years or longer

Tour model homes and/or homes that the builder built for past buyers or furnished and decorated model homes that’s open to the public. If visiting a builder’s recently built home is out of the question, the best alternative is to visit model homes. Pay careful attention to the look, feel and quality of the home.

So, as you can see, choosing the right home builder is not such a complicated process. It may take some time but it will be all worth it!
